To keep an account active and prevent the automatic deprovisioning process, IT support staff must add an eligible guest-type affiliation to the user’s record in PennCommunity and an override.ĭoes the department need the mail that already exists in the account? Once an account is deprovisioned, all functionality stops immediately and all data is deleted and becomes unrecoverable 30 days later. IMPORTANT: Considerations A, B, C, D, and E are only available until the separated user’s account is deprovisioned. If the user is not available, IT support staff can perform the actions after granting themselves Full and SendAs access to the user’s mailbox in ARS. Note that most of these actions can be performed by the end user if they are available prior to leaving the University. When a PennO365 user separates from the University, IT support staff should review the considerations below with the user’s department and perform the relevant actions as needed. Considerations for PennO365 User Separation ![]() Organizational account transfers are performed by ISC at the request of school/center IT support staff. Please note that the process for preparing for a user’s separation from the University is different from process to transfer a user’s account from one organization to another at Penn. This article summarizes the specific tasks IT support staff must perform prior to account deprovisioning to ensure the account is configured to meet the business needs of the department at user separation and/or maintain an account’s functionality following user separation. When a person leaves the University, their former organization at Penn often needs to either have access to the user’s existing mailbox and/or continue to receive new messages that are sent to the user’s account.
